What Factors Influence the Cost of a Total Home Security System?
Several factors influence the cost of a total home security system:
- Type of Security System: The cost varies based on whether the system is a DIY setup, monitored service, or a professionally installed system. DIY systems usually have lower upfront costs but may lack features like 24/7 monitoring, while professionally installed systems can offer comprehensive solutions but at a higher price.
- Equipment Quality: The brand and quality of the equipment significantly affect the price. High-end systems often come equipped with advanced technology such as smart home integration, high-resolution cameras, and durable sensors, which can increase the overall cost.
- Features and Customization: The inclusion of additional features like motion detectors, glass break sensors, and video surveillance can raise costs. Customization options that allow homeowners to tailor the system to their specific needs will also impact pricing, as more complex systems typically require a higher investment.
- Monitoring Services: The choice between self-monitoring and professional monitoring services plays a crucial role in cost. Professional monitoring usually entails a monthly fee, which can add up over time, while self-monitoring systems may have lower ongoing costs but require the homeowner to respond to alerts.
- Installation Costs: The method of installation can influence the total price, with professional installations generally costing more than DIY options. Complex installations that require extensive wiring or integration with existing home systems can further increase labor costs.
- Geographic Location: The cost of security systems can also vary based on the region due to differences in labor costs and market demand. Areas with higher crime rates may have higher pricing for security systems due to increased demand for protective measures.
- Warranty and Support: Systems that come with extended warranties or robust customer support services may have higher upfront costs. Investing in warranties can be beneficial in the long run, as it can save money on repairs or replacements.
How Does Smart Technology Improve Home Security Effectiveness?
Smart technology significantly enhances home security effectiveness through various innovative features and systems.
- Smart Cameras: These devices provide real-time video surveillance, allowing homeowners to monitor their property remotely via smartphones or computers.
- Smart Locks: Offering keyless entry and remote locking/unlocking capabilities, smart locks enhance security by eliminating the need for physical keys that can be lost or duplicated.
- Motion Sensors: Integrated with smart technology, these sensors can detect movement and send alerts to homeowners, enabling quick responses to potential intrusions.
- Alarm Systems: Smart alarm systems can be programmed to notify homeowners and authorities immediately in case of a breach, significantly reducing response time.
- Home Automation: This allows for the integration of lighting and other devices to create the illusion of occupancy, deterring potential burglars.
- Smart Doorbells: Equipped with video and two-way audio, these devices let homeowners see and communicate with visitors from anywhere, enhancing security at entry points.
Smart Cameras not only record footage but can also employ advanced features like facial recognition and night vision, providing comprehensive surveillance and peace of mind. They can be programmed to send notifications when movement is detected, allowing for immediate action if necessary.
Smart Locks improve security by allowing homeowners to control access to their property remotely. They often feature temporary access codes for guests or service providers and can log entry times, ensuring that homeowners are aware of who enters and exits their home.
Motion Sensors can be placed strategically around the home to detect unusual activity. They are often connected to smart security systems that can trigger alarms or cameras when motion is detected, ensuring that any suspicious behavior is promptly addressed.
Alarm Systems have evolved with smart technology, allowing for features such as smartphone alerts, remote monitoring, and integration with local law enforcement. This ensures a swift response in emergencies, which is crucial for minimizing potential losses.
Home Automation enhances security by allowing homeowners to program lights to turn on and off at certain times, making it appear as if someone is home even when they are not. This can deter burglars who often look for empty houses as targets.
Smart Doorbells provide an added layer of security at entrances, offering features that allow residents to see who is at their door without opening it. This can be especially useful for screening visitors or packages and can help prevent package theft.

What Are the Different Installation Options for Home Security Systems?
There are several installation options available for home security systems to cater to different needs and preferences:
- Professional Installation: This option involves hiring trained technicians to install the security system at your home. Professionals ensure that all components are correctly placed and functioning, often providing a warranty on their work, but this service may come with additional costs.
- DIY Installation: Many modern security systems are designed for easy self-installation, allowing homeowners to set up the system without professional help. This can save money and provides flexibility, as you can install the system at your own pace, but it may require some technical know-how for optimal setup.
- Self-Monitoring Systems: These systems are typically easy to install and allow homeowners to manage and monitor their security directly through mobile apps. They may not offer professional monitoring services, but they provide real-time alerts and control, making them ideal for tech-savvy individuals comfortable with managing their security.
- Hardwired Systems: Hardwired systems involve physically installing cables throughout the home for a permanent setup. While they are often more reliable and less susceptible to interference, installation can be invasive and usually requires professional assistance to ensure proper integration with existing structures.
- Wireless Systems: Wireless security systems use Wi-Fi or cellular connections, allowing for easier installation without the need for extensive wiring. They offer flexibility in terms of placement and are often portable, but they may rely on battery power, requiring regular maintenance to ensure functionality.
- Hybrid Systems: Combining both hardwired and wireless components, hybrid systems provide the reliability of wired connections in key areas while allowing for the flexibility of wireless devices in others. This option can optimize coverage and performance, but it may involve a more complex installation process.
How Can You Determine the Right Total Home Security System for Your Home?
Determining the best total home security system involves evaluating several key factors.
- Assess Your Security Needs: Identifying your specific security requirements is essential before selecting a system. Consider factors such as the size of your home, the number of entry points, and any previous security incidents to tailor your system effectively.
- Research Different Types of Systems: There are various types of security systems, including wired, wireless, and hybrid options. Each type has its own installation requirements and levels of reliability, so understanding the differences can help you choose a system that fits your lifestyle and preferences.
- Evaluate Monitoring Options: Decide whether you want a self-monitored system or one that comes with professional monitoring services. Professional monitoring may offer faster response times and additional peace of mind, while self-monitoring can be more cost-effective and allow for greater control.
- Consider Smart Home Integration: Many modern security systems offer compatibility with smart home devices. If you already have smart technology in your home, choosing a system that integrates seamlessly with these devices can enhance convenience and functionality.
- Check for Mobile App Features: A good security system should come with a user-friendly mobile app that allows you to monitor your home remotely. Look for features such as real-time alerts, camera feeds, and the ability to control devices from your smartphone to ensure you stay connected.
- Read Customer Reviews and Ratings: Gathering insights from current users can provide valuable information about a system’s reliability and effectiveness. Pay attention to feedback regarding customer service, ease of installation, and overall satisfaction to guide your decision-making process.
- Compare Costs and Contracts: Different systems come with varying price points and contract terms. Evaluate both upfront costs and ongoing fees, including equipment, installations, and monitoring services, to ensure you find a solution that fits your budget.
- Look for Warranty and Support Options: A good warranty can protect your investment and provide peace of mind. Additionally, check the availability of customer support to ensure you have help when needed, especially during installation or if issues arise with the system.
